针对某厂房发生火灾之后,现场破坏严重,难以开展火灾调查和相关责任追究等现实问题,采用火灾后果数值模拟分析的方法,选择实际的起火部位设定两种不同的火灾场景,并对不同火灾场景下的烟气层安全高度、毒害性、能见度和清晰层温度进行模拟。通过定量和定性的软件分析,判断该厂房是否存在乱堆乱放等违法违规行为,同时通过模拟计算和传统火灾调查结果进行对照,验证模拟计算的合理性,为其他功能厂房或库房的火灾后果计算提供借鉴。
